According to 6Wresearch internal database and industry insights, the Global Vitamin C Market was valued at USD 1.1 Billion in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 1.6 Billion by 2031, growing at a compound annual growth rate of 4.70% during the forecast period (2025-2031).
The Global Vitamin C Market is experiencing steady growth due to increasing consumer awareness of the health benefits associated with Vitamin C consumption. Factors such as the rising prevalence of lifestyle diseases and the growing trend of preventive healthcare practices are driving the market expansion. The market is characterized by a wide range of product offerings, including tablets, capsules, powders, and liquids, catering to diverse consumer preferences. Key players in the industry are focusing on product innovation, quality assurance, and strategic partnerships to maintain a competitive edge in the market. Geographically, the Asia Pacific region dominates the market, followed by North America and Europe. The market is expected to continue its growth trajectory in the coming years, driven by the increasing demand for dietary supplements and fortified food and beverage products.

The Global Vitamin C Market faces challenges such as price volatility due to fluctuations in raw material costs, increasing competition from alternative sources of vitamin C such as synthetic forms, regulatory constraints related to quality standards and labeling requirements, and shifting consumer preferences towards natural and organic products. Additionally, supply chain disruptions, geopolitical tensions impacting trade, and the impact of the COVID-19 pandemic on manufacturing and distribution channels have also posed challenges for the Vitamin C market. Market players need to adapt to these challenges by focusing on innovation, sustainability, and diversification of sourcing strategies to maintain competitiveness in the evolving market landscape.

Government policies related to the Global Vitamin C Market typically focus on regulations regarding production standards, labeling requirements, and import/export restrictions to ensure product safety and quality. Regulatory bodies such as the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) in the United States and the European Food Safety Authority (EFSA) in the European Union set guidelines for manufacturers to follow in order to maintain compliance with established standards. Additionally, governments may also impose tariffs or quotas on the import and export of Vitamin C products to protect domestic producers or address trade imbalances. These policies play a crucial role in shaping the competitive landscape of the Global Vitamin C Market and ensuring consumer confidence in the products available in the market.
